6.5
Magnet Placement
The magnet’s center axis should be aligned within a displacement radius Rd of 0.25 mm (larger magnets allow more
displacement e.g. 0.5 mm) from the defined center of the IC.
The magnet may be placed below or above the device. The distance should be chosen such that the magnetic field on the
die surface is within the specified limits The typical distance “z” between the magnet and the package surface is 0.5mm to
2.5mm, provided the use of the recommended magnet material and dimensions (6mm x 3mm). Larger distances are
possible, as long as the required magnetic field strength stays within the defined limits.
However, a magnetic field outside the specified range may still produce usable results, but the out-of-range condition will be
indicated by indication flags.
